Label qui ne change qu'une seule fois ...
Bonjour,
une partie du code suivant ne s'exécute qu'une seule fois !!
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
|
function pf_cache()
{
vf_tab_edition=document.getElementById("bt_gesaff");
vf_panneau=document.getElementById("hbox_panneaudegauche");
vf_label=vf_tab_edition.label
//alert(vf_label);
if(vf_label=="Afficher le panneau de gauche") {
//alert('il faut afficher');
vf_tab_edition.setAttribute("label","Cacher le panneau de gauche");
vf_panneau.setAttribute("hidden",false);
}
else
vf_panneau.setAttribute("hidden",true);
vf_tab_edition.setAttribute("label","Afficher le panneau de gauche");
} |
A savoir que le label initial est "Cacher le panneau de gauche"
Etape 1 -> on click, pas de souci, le panneau de gauche devient invisible et le label passe à "Afficher le panneau de gauche"
Etape 2 souci : le panneau redevient visible mais le label ne change plus !! Donc ensuite impossible de re cacher le panneau de gauche. J'imagine que ce doit être une grosse erreur de ma part, mais je ne la vois "plus", tellement je regarde le code ...
Merci de me dépanner,
--
Cordialement,
Christophe Charron